Q: The Gildhall seat-map renderer is serving blank maps — what do I do?

A: Blank maps almost always mean the venue-geometry cache expired and the renderer can't reach the Stagecraft layout service to rebuild it. First, check that the layout service pods are healthy; if they are, flush the renderer's cache and it will repopulate within a minute. If the admin panel has locked you out due to repeated cache-flush attempts, it will prompt for the recovery passphrase, which appears below.

recovery phrase for bawep-kawef: oliath-casdor

**Ticket PARITY-412: Kestrel SDK catch-up**

Quick one for the weekly sync: the Kestrel-Go SDK is still missing batched uploads and retry hints that Kestrel-JS shipped two releases ago. Partner teams keep asking. Plan is to land both behind a flag this sprint and cut a minor release. Needs a sign-off from the owner named below.

account owner for bajef-badup: Drueth Kelath Pelael Holwyn

Alert: Intermittent DNS resolution failures observed on the Quellwood edge resolvers serving the Pindrift cluster. Roughly 4% of lookups for internal service names time out, then succeed on retry, suggesting a flaky upstream rather than an outage. Before restarting resolver pods, capture a query trace so we can correlate with the forwarder logs. The triage checklist is maintained on the internal page below.

runbook for tafof-yawif: https://confluence.tolvaqsys.internal/display/display/browse/pages/7be3

## 2.14.1 — Key Rotation & Orders Soft Deletes

This release rotates the database signing credentials alongside the soft-delete migration on the orders table in Quillbase. Rows are no longer hard-deleted; a deleted_at column is set and the archiver sweeps them after 90 days. All downstream consumers must filter on deleted_at IS NULL. Because the migration bundle is signed with the rotated credential, the old key stops validating at cutover. Release manager: verify the checksum manifest before promoting to production. The new deploy key follows.

release key, fajef-kajeg: bky19_LdLu6Ne6FLi8he2c24d